Join the Sol Dog Volunteer Pack
We’re so glad you’re thinking about joining our amazing volunteer community! Volunteers are at the heart of everything we do at Sol Dog Lodge. Whether it’s helping dogs feel safe and loved, supporting families, or assisting with events, your time and energy make a big difference.
Here’s how to get started:
Apply Online
Head to our volunteer sign-up page and click “Sign Up For This Organization” to create your account and fill out the Volunteer Application.We Review & Reach Out
Our Volunteer Coordinator will review your application within 24–48 hours. You can always log in to make changes to your answers if needed.Let’s Meet
If it looks like a good fit, you’ll get an email inviting you to schedule a time for an in-person interview and tour of our facility. It’s a great way for us to get to know each other!Background Check
After the tour, we’ll send you a link to complete a background check. This is required for all volunteers before they begin working with us.Get Ready to Roll
Once you’re approved and your background check is cleared, we’ll send you our onboarding materials—including training, our Volunteer Code of Conduct, a Liability Waiver, and a few other forms.You’re In!
After your onboarding is complete, you can begin scheduling shifts and joining us around the lodge.
Please note: the full process usually takes 1–3 weeks depending on scheduling and paperwork.

Volunteer Roles at Sol Dog Lodge
There are many ways to lend a paw! Some of our core volunteer opportunities include:
Dog Care – Assist with daily routines such as feeding and enrichment
Training Assistance – Support our trainers with class prep and observation
Administrative Help – Lend a hand with data entry, office support, and more
Facility Support – Help us maintain a clean and welcoming environment
Event Support – Join us at community outreach and fundraising events
Additional training is required to handle dogs directly. Once approved, we’ll provide the guidance you need to get started safely.

Foster a Dog
Fostering is one of the most meaningful ways you can support Sol Dog Lodge.
As a foster, you’ll provide a loving temporary home for a dog until a forever placement is found. We provide food, supplies, and medical care. You provide the space, patience, and love that helps a dog adjust, recover, and thrive.
